Amplitude scintillations on 251 MHz signal recorded by spaced receivers at Tirunelveli (8.7°N, 77.8°E, dip latitude 0.6°N) for eight months during 1995–2005 are utilized in present work. Power spectral analysis of weak scintillations (0.15≤S4≤0.5)(0.15≤S4≤0.5) is carried out and spectral index, m of ESF irregularities, is computed for quiet and disturbed days. Maximum cross-correlation, CI(x0,tm)CI(x0,tm), of intensity variations between two receivers is used to identify the fresh generation of EPBs resulted from magnetic activity. Increase in F-region height is seen prior to the generation of these fresh EPBs and associated ESF irregularities found to possess shallower power spectrum.
► Disturbed days with freshly generated EPBs are likely to have small scale length.
► Spectral slope is found to decrease with decrease in maximum cross-correlation CICI.
► Enhancement in h′Fh′F is seen prior to the fresh generation of EPBs on disturbed days.
